- The distance between Matad, Mongolia and Lundazi, Zambia is approximately 10,445 km or 6,490 mi.
- To reach Matad in this distance one would set out from Lundazi bearing 42.5°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Matad bearing 76.1° or ENE .
- Matad has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Lundazi has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- Matad is in or near the boreal dry scrub biome whereas Lundazi is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 20.1 °C (36.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 33.9 °C (61°F) more in Matad.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 732.4 mm (28.8 in) less which is equivalent to 732.4 l/m² (17.97 US gal/ft²) or 7,324,000 l/ha (782,984 US gal/ac) less. About 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 29.2° lower in Matad than in Lundazi.
